Published May 7, 2026, 2:00 p.m. ET There’s something to be said about the use of restraint in a crime drama. Less chases and gunfights, a script not trying so hard to be funny… it all adds up to a show that demands attention, like the new Netflix series Legends . LEGENDS : STREAM IT OR SKIP IT?  Opening Shot: A teenager exits his apartment and picks up a soccer ball. “Liverpool. 1990.” The Gist:   We see the teen going to a party with his friends, where they shoot up heroin, only the teen ends up being unresponsive. At Oxford University, a group of students smoke heroin after a formal, and one of the women in elegant dresses is shown to also be unresponsive. At the London offices of Her Majesty’s Customs and Excise, director of investigations Angus Blake (Douglas Hodge) and his head of operations, Don Clark (Steve Coogan), read about both deaths, and Blake gets called into his boss’ office.
